Abstract (EN)
Today, energy demands are increasing as a result of the rapid increase in the world population, industrialization and advances in technology. The limited conventional energy resources in the world reveals the necessity for countries to use their resources more effectively and efficiently. European Union candidate Turkey, a country with a young population that is a developing country with industrialization and dynamic economic power structure. Therefore, energy needs of Turkey is increasing day by day. Determination of the energy and environmental performance among the member countries due to its geostrategic location where Turkey is located is important. In this study, Turkey's energy and environmental parameters into consideration, from the point of determining the position of movement between EU member states have created seven different models. These models are renewable energy efficiency, energy production and potency efficiency, energy potency efficiency, renewable energy efficiency according to gross final energy consumption, greenhouse gas emission efficiency, import dependency efficiency and electricity price efficiency. According to Turkey's EU country comparative analysis section, DEA and Malmquist Index was conducted utilizing the method. A country's Malmquist productivity index being greater than 1.0 indicates an improvement in its efficiency. DEA is a nonparametric method used for efficiency evaluation for similar types of decision-making units (DMU) using more than one input and output variables. Data of 30 European countries between 2015 and 2017 were used in the analyzes. Turkey's 2017 average Malmquist indices of 1,058, 1,000, 0,990, 0,880, 0.490, 0,717 and 1,248. As a result, Turkey's gross renewable energy efficiency model based on final energy consumption, energy production and productivity effectiveness model and price of electricity efficiency model has been found to show improvement compared to the EU countries.
